Dr. Howard J. Tzorfas, D. P. M., is a Board Certified surgeon and podiatrist specializing in both surgical and non-surgical treatments. We have solutions for just about any condition affecting the foot, including ingrown & fungus nails, corns & calluses, sports injuries, diabetic care, hammer toes, heel pain, bunions and warts.

Dr. Howard Tzorfas, Board Certified in both Podiatric medicine and Podiatric surgery has been practicing in New Jersey since 1987. He is a member of the American Podiatric Medical Associate, New Jersey Podiatric Medical Association, the American Association of Podiatric Physicians and Surgeons and the American Diabetes Association. 

Dr. Tzorfas, a native of New Jersey, received a Bachelor of Science degree in Biology from Montclair State College in 1982. In 1986, he received his degree, Doctor of Podiatric Medicine from the Pennsylvania College of Podiatric Medicine. He completed his residency at The Veterans Administration Medical Center in Richmond, Virginia in 1987. 

Dr. Tzorfas is on staff at 

  • Hunterdon Medical Center

  • St. Luke's Warren Hospital

  • Carrier Foundation

  • Hunterdon Developmental Center.

  • Hunterdon Center for Surgery

In addition to his general podiatry practice, Dr. Tzorfas has special interests in Sports Medicine, diabetes and children’s foot problems. 

As an active member of the community, Dr. Tzorfas holds the honor of serving as the official podiatrist for the American Diabetes Association Walk-a-thon and the March of Dimes Walk-a-thon. He also serves the community by offering free foot screenings for Senior Health fairs and local companies and conducts lectures throughout the county for hospitals, clubs and service organizations.
